With the increasing interest and care to Erbil province related with the priority for producing and supplying of potable water, three water treatment plants (WTP) were constructed during the last decades. Water quality for physical, chemical and bacteriological parameters were monitored in 15 sampling sites of three WTPs (Ifraz 1, 2 and 3) in Erbil governorate from May 2008 to Jan. 2009 at monthly interval period, each WTPs were divided in to five sampling sites according to treatment units. Results of water sample analysis were as follow: Turbidity values ranged between 0.2 to 29NTU, while pH values ranged from 7 to 8.3, and electrical conductivity were ranged from 340 to 773 μS.cm, total alkalinity and chloride ion were ranged from 92 to 181mg. CaCO3.l and 8 to 28 mg.l respectively. Total hardness for the studied sites were 128 to 308 mg.CaCO3.l, magnesium hardness is sure asses on calcium hardness. Dissolved oxygen (DO) values were ranged from 3.2 to 11.6 mg.l1. High BOD5 values were recorded in raw water and sedimentation units in all WTPs, while the low values were recorded in filtration and storage units of all WTPs at different times. Nitrite concentrations at the major treatment units estimated to be between (0.006 to 2.96 μg at.N-NO2.l ). Generally, potassium concentrations were lower than sodium. Sulphate concentration showed a range of 191 to 541 mg.l. The range of reactive phosphorus was between 0.15 to 10.5 μg.at.P-PO4.l, and Jar test results was between 4 and 28ppm. Bacteriologically, MPN for coliform.100ml in treated waters were safe for drinking purposes according to WHO reports.
